Frontal Lobe
The part of the brain associated with decision making, problem solving, control of purposeful behaviors, consciousness, and emotions.
Intelligence A
Hebb’s term for innate intellectual potential, which is highly heritable and cannot be measured directly.
Convergent Thinking
A cognitive process in which a person focuses on a single, optimal solution to a problem, contrasting with divergent thinking.
Frontal Lobe Injury
Damage to the frontal part of the brain, affecting mood, behavior, and cognitive functions.
